Marks Rod and Reel Repair

Sports shop

0.0
(0 Reviews)
13951 E County Road 462, 49868 Newberry

Industries / Specializations

Sports shop

Map

13951 E County Road 462, 49868 Newberry

Reviews

Unverified Reviews
0.0
(0 Reviews)